About this Event
The biggest concern families have about senior living isn’t whether it’s the right choice—it’s how to pay for it without draining everything at once.
If you’re exploring independent living, assisted living, or memory care—for yourself or a loved one—this workshop will give you a clear, practical understanding of the financial options available.
You’ll learn how families on the San Mateo Peninsula are navigating this transition using a combination of income, savings, insurance, and home equity—so decisions can be made thoughtfully, not under pressure.
In this workshop, you’ll learn:
• How to use home equity strategically to support senior living
• Loan and reverse mortgage options—explained in simple terms
• Local San Mateo County programs and resources you may not know about
• Real-life examples of how families successfully fund the move
You’ll also hear insights from the Executive Director of The Trousdale Senior Living Community, who will share what they see families do every day when making this transition.
Whether you’re planning ahead or facing a more immediate decision, this session is designed to help you move forward with clarity and confidence.
